Iowa Code

Iowa Code § 312.1 (2026)

Fund created

1. There is hereby created, in the state treasury, a road use tax fund. The road use tax fund shall include all of the following:

a. All the net proceeds of the registration of motor vehicles under chapter 321.

b. All the net proceeds of the motor fuel tax or license fees under chapter 452A.

c. Revenue derived from the excise tax imposed upon the rental of automobiles, under chapter 423C, to the extent provided by section 321.145, subsection 2.

d. Revenue derived from the use tax collected under sections 423.26 and 423.26A, to the extent provided under section 321.145, subsection 2.

e. Any other funds which may by law be credited to the road use tax fund.

2. Notwithstanding section 12C.7, subsection 2, interest or earnings on investments or time deposits of the moneys in the road use tax fund and the funds to which moneys from the road use tax fund are credited shall be credited to the road use tax fund.
